Detached House in Tochigi City with Well Water and Private Road Considerations
This detached house, built in May 1984, is located in a quiet residential area of Tochigi City, Tochigi Prefecture. The property offers convenient access to public transport, with Yashuhirakawa Station on the Tobu Utsunomiya Line just a 3-minute walk (approximately 232 meters) away. Nearby amenities include a Seven-Eleven convenience store within a 456-meter walk and a York-Benimaru supermarket approximately 773 meters from the home.
The property features a total floor area of 85.01 square meters (approximately 25.7 tsubo) on a land plot of 202.37 square meters (approximately 61.2 tsubo). The layout is a 5DK configuration, spread over two stories. The interior includes a mix of Japanese-style rooms (washitsu) and Western-style rooms (yoshitsu) across both floors, a dining kitchen, bathroom, washbasin area, and toilet. The house is equipped with air conditioning, a balcony, and a back door (勝手口).
Critical agent notes provide essential details about the property's utilities and legal status. The equipment includes LPG gas, a private well for water supply (水道:井戸), and a sewer drainage system (排水種類:下水). Important remarks indicate there is no private road passage agreement (私道通行承諾書無し), there are unregistered structures on the property (未登記建物あり), and the property is subject to the Landscape Act (景観法). The property is currently vacant. Parking is available for one vehicle. The land is zoned for industrial use within an urbanization promotion area.
